Minimum matrix representation of closure operations
نویسندگان
چکیده
Let (I be a column of the fft x /I matrix M and A a set of its columns. We say that A implies a iff M contains no two rows equal in A but different in a. It is easy IO see that if Y,~,(A) denotes . the columns implied by A, than :/,,,(A) is a closure operation. We say that M represents this closure operation. s(:/ ) is the minimum number of the rows of the matrices representing a given closure operation. s(? ) is determined for some particular closure operations.

متن کاملMatrix representation of a sixth order Sturm-Liouville problem and related inverse problem with finite spectrum
In this paper, we find matrix representation of a class of sixth order Sturm-Liouville problem (SLP) with separated, self-adjoint boundary conditions and we show that such SLP have finite spectrum. متن کاملAll-Pairs Common-Ancestor Problems in Weighted Dags
This work considers the (lowest) common ancestor problem in weighted directed acyclic graphs. The minimum-weight (lowest) common ancestor of two vertices is the vertex among the set of (lowest) common ancestors with the smallest ancestral distance. متن کاملOn the solving matrix equations by using the spectral representation
The purpose of this paper is to solve two types of Lyapunov equations and quadratic matrix equations by using the spectral representation. We focus on solving Lyapunov equations $AX+XA^*=C$ and $AX+XA^{T}=-bb^{T}$ for $A, X in mathbb{C}^{n times n}$ and $b in mathbb{C} ^{n times s}$ with $s < n$, which $X$ is unknown matrix.
